Transaction 232577483610331779c6fb6cc6da008e7a659889962a384b201a2a1f5627cc83
1 Input
1 Output
-
232577483610331779c6fb6cc6da008e7a659889962a384b201a2a1f5627cc83:0
- value
- 8717914
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1e640ff877cc8a76c733b7ecd606daff2f0ef22
- address
- bc1qc8nyplu80ny2wmrn8dlv6crd4le0pmezpy046m